Хорошо спроектированный интерфейс делает продукт удобным, привлекательным и запоминающимся для пользователя. Минимализм и простота – это не просто слова, а философия, которая пронизывает современные интерфейсы. Упрощенные элементы и темные фоны делают Язык программирования наш пользовательский опыт более интуитивным и приятным.
Методы по умолчанию в интерфейсах в Java
Наконец, инклюзивный дизайн стал неотъемлемой частью нашего творчества. Мы стремимся сделать интерфейсы удобными и доступными для каждого, независимо от их возможностей. Отзывчивый UI реагирует на действия пользователя мгновенно, обеспечивая быстрый отклик на нажатия кнопок и взаимодействие с элементами. Респонсивность создает ощущение непрерывности и уверенности во время использования продукта. Это означает, что интерфейс должен быть доступен для всех пользователей, включая людей с ограниченными возможностями. Обеспечение контрастности, читаемости текста и https://deveducation.com/ удобства использования для людей с ограниченными возможностями гарантирует, что продукт будет доступен для широкого круга пользователей.
User interface это не просто украшение продукта
Основная цель UI — обеспечить api что это пользователям удобство, эффективность и удовлетворение от использования продукта.
Сколько времени занимает разработка интерфейса приложения?
Эстетичный дизайн и брендинг придают большее значение чувству и эмоциональной связи. Иногда необходимость внедрения каких-либо функций возникает уже после запуска приложения. На определенном этапе растущему бизнесу становится «тесно» в существующем приложении, аудитория требует новых опций. Современные технологии мобильной разработки позволяют масштабировать функционал, адаптировать приложение под новые потребности пользователей. Исключение составляют сильно устаревшие приложения, доработка которых обойдется дороже, чем создание нового продукта.
❤️ Какой пример итеративного процесса?
Может применяться ручное или автоматизированное тестирование, о которых мы рассказали ранее, кроссбраузерное тестирование, тестирование на различных гаджетах и т. Также на этом этапе выбираются инструменты автоматизации, если это предусмотрено. Тестируя интерфейс пользователя, необходимо проверить все его элементы, среди которых текст, цвета, изображения, поля ввода, текстовые поля, значки, списки и так далее.
Написать лямбда выражение, которое принимает на вход число и возвращает значение “Положительное число”, “Отрицательное число” или “Ноль”. Прототипирование приложений – крайне важный этап разработки, позволяющий в будущем уменьшить время общей работы над проектом и уменьшить требуемый для его реализации бюджет. Для создания хорошего прототипа разработчики используют различные сервисы, включая и бесплатные их версии, позволяющие предоставить заказчику детализированный макет с переходами, связями и даже анимацией. Выбор подобных программ велик, и каждый специалист или mobile-студия выбирает наиболее привлекательный вариант для себя и своих клиентов. Одной из самых популярных программ для создания прототипов, которой можно пользоваться бесплатно при условии реализации не больше 2-х проектов, является Marvel. Она имеет отличный функционал и относительно проста в освоении, позволяет создавать прекрасные постраничные прототипы с возможностью закрепления таббара и навбара.
- UI обеспечивает понимание функционала продукта и позволяет пользователю взаимодействовать с ним.
- Если интерфейс приложения комплексно не проверить на отсутствие ошибок и недочетов, это может привести к тому, что со всеми этими недостатками и ошибками в конечном итоге столкнутся пользователи.
- Обычно люди стараются избегать регистрироваться там, куда они не собираются заходить регулярно, либо еще не уверены в этом.
- Когда класс в Java имплементирует один или несколько интерфейсов, он открывает двери множеству возможностей.
- Подумайте о времени ваших клиентов, пользователь не хочет читать горы «всплывашек», чтобы просто сделать покупку.
Взаимодействие с кодом проходит через протокол HTTP и соответствующие браузеры. С помощью этого интерфейса обеспечивается подключение устройств к системе. HTML, CSS и JavaScript — основные языки программирования для разработки UI веб-сайтов. Такие тенденции не только определяют сегодняшний день, но и вдохновляют разработчиков на создание интерфейсов будущего – интерфейсов, которые не только функциональны, но и красивы, удобны и доступны для всех.
Сегодня же технические характеристики процессоров, оперативной памяти, видеокарт достигли таких показателей, что влияние визуальных эффектов на быстродействие системы стало едва заметным. Функции современного программного интерфейса отображаются в дружелюбном и интуитивно понятном для пользователя виде. При сравнении, например, графической среды Windows 11 и Windows 95 разница будет видна невооруженным взглядом. В первых компьютерах функции интерфейса пользователя отображались в виде числовых и текстовых символов.
Могут быть представлены в виде всплывающих окон, баннеров или текстовых сообщений. Сообщения и уведомления должны быть четко сформулированы, вовремя появляться и не перегружать пользователя лишней информацией. Текстовые поля используются для ввода и редактирования текста.
Создание сайта современного уровня – кропотливая и взаимосвязанная работа разных специалистов. Даже самый «навороченный» функционал окажется бесполезным, если не будет качественно продуман пользовательский интерфейс. UI/UX специалист создает дизайн приложения, прорабатывает расположение функциональных элементов, кнопок, форм, меню. UI дизайн делает интерфейс красивым и приятным для восприятия, а UX – удобным и полезным для решения пользовательских задач. Важно максимально проработать каждую деталь интерфейса на этапе прототипирования.
Сенсорные жесты, такие как смахивание, масштабирование и вращение, стали стандартом в мобильных устройствах. Голосовые помощники, такие как Siri, Alexa и Google Assistant, позволяют пользователям взаимодействовать с устройствами голосом, делая процессы управления устройствами более естественными. Таким образом, хороший интерфейс пользователя это не просто деталь дизайна, а стратегический инструмент, способствующий росту бизнеса и удовлетворению потребностей пользователей. На веб-сайтах хорошо продуманный интерфейс может увеличить конверсию сеансов посетителей в реальные продажи или другие целевые действия. Простота навигации, ясность представления информации и удобство оформления заказа — все это аспекты, которые могут повысить конверсию и уровень доходов компании. Написать лямбда выражение, которое возвращает случайное число от 0 до 10.
Хорошо продуманный и интуитивно понятный сервис создает уникальный опыт взаимодействия. Он не только облегчает навигацию и доступ к информации, но и придает web-ресурсу своеобразный стиль и узнаваемость, что становится визитной карточкой сайта, определяющей его успешность и привлекательность. Пользовательский интерфейс это не просто визуальное представление web-страницы, но и способ, с помощью которого взаимодействуют с вашим контентом.
Не существует правильного способа создания пользовательского интерфейса. Но есть переход от линейного подхода к итеративному, где сотрудничество является ключевым, а идеи постоянно согласовываются. Это подход, который часто начинается с того, что стало известно как фаза открытия. Чтобы оценить производительность сайта или приложения, UI-специалисты определяют скорость, с которой загружаются страницы и контент, особенно если изображения высокого качества. Цель — убедиться, что продукт не тормозит и открывается за пару секунд.
Это гарантирует отсутствие сюрпризов, когда компания запускает свой новый сайт, и публика видит его впервые. В конце концов, пользователи тестировали его на каждом этапе. Поэтому вместо детальной спецификации все, что требуется, это хорошо сформулированные цели. Помимо этого, вам необходимо глубокое понимание вашей аудитории и того, как будет выглядеть успех с их точки зрения. Это значительно сократит время, затрачиваемое до начала работы. Ответ на вопрос о том, чего хотят достичь посетители сайта, можно узнать с помощью исследований пользователей.
UI состоит из нейронных компонентов, каждый из которых обеспечивает удобство и эффективность взаимодействия пользователя с системой. Пользователь не может взаимодействовать напрямую с кодом программы. Для этого ему нужна картинка, где он будет видеть код, иметь возможность менять его и видеть изменения на этой картинке. Здесь не обойтись без четкой структуры и графических элементов, даже самых примитивных. Сохранить моё имя, email и адрес сайта в этом браузере для последующих моих комментариев. Можно выделить следующие требования, которым должны соответствовать интерфейс ресурса.
Тот же базовый принцип применяется независимо от того, работаете ли вы над информационной архитектурой или любым другим аспектом дизайна пользовательского интерфейса. На этапе обнаружения будут определены многие вопросы, на которые пользователи хотят ответить, и задачи, которые они хотят выполнить. Это основа для вашего нового сайта и соответствующего дизайна пользовательского интерфейса.